Starting in 2015, Florida required every high school student to take one 100% online course/class in order to graduate. . Clearly online learning in elementary and secondary schools were well on their way by the early 2000’s, which puts a big dent into the whole “new experience of learning online” argument. .
In the United States, it is even an option for teenagers to take all of their classes online (in some school districts). Certainly the course content is important but also the delivery method. In my opinion, a blended learning approach where possible will help with learning retention.

SCORM began as an initiative from the Department of Defense, which wanted to modernize technology-based education and training and expand distancelearning initiatives. Harness the power of the Internet and other virtual or private wide-area networks (WANs) to deliver high-quality learning. First, a little history about SCORM.
